Output 8deb86a56f093791541ba99114b4a58bc8e6e1cce3783a0293977855ea48188b:1

value
5598666606
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c715abf08c323e31301f15d938869d3be36b297 OP_EQUAL
address
3EVcKQa1fHfJG2eMiQkMBzFMAY83w1amVi
transaction
8deb86a56f093791541ba99114b4a58bc8e6e1cce3783a0293977855ea48188b
spent
true